UW Person Registry data is accessible via two programmatic interfaces:
- Whatami: provides access to all Person Registry data. Available for Windows and UNIX.
- UW.EDS.Person: provides access to the limited set of Person data that is published in the UW Person Directory.

Access to Person Registry data is, in general, limited to the privileged Central Administrative applications developed and maintained by C&C.
To request access to the Person Registry data, via the whatami client or a batch feed, use the Person Registry Data Access Request form.
To request access to the Person Registry data, via the UW.EDS.Person component, use the UW.EDS.Person Access Request form.
Whatami COM
Whatami COM is for use on Windows 2000, 2003, XP. This distribution contains the whatami DLL, config file, installation procedure, developer documentation, release notes, and example/verification code in the form of a VBS script.
A separate key file (not included in the distribution for security reasons) is required for access to the Person Registry data. Email iam-support@u.washington.edu to arrange for secure key transfer.

Whatami UNIX
Whatami UNIX is available for the most recent versions of RHE Linux and AIX. There is no download for Whatami UNIX at this time.
